  6. Aggressive-Mud-7699

    You can hunt them at night with a blacklight flashlight. You can get a cheap one online and spend a few minutes every few nights easily spotting them because they glow really bright under blacklight. Makes it super easy if you have a dense garden or a lot of tomato plants.
